FIRST 5 YEARS:(Thursday -Forrest Ciy, Arkansas)
I slept in today and rolled around in the bed as I had nothing else to do. I updated my log book, did a vehicle inspection and walked over to a restaurant and had lunch. I tried to get loaded early but they would not load me. They actually did load me a little early as my appointment was for 8:00 PM and they loaded to me at 5:00 PM. I got to watch them loaded and it was all big televisions. They were going to the Best Buy store warehouse in Bloomington, Minnesota. The loaders had problems with the last few boxes so they had to put them in sideways; they got them in and I was glad I did't have to unload them.
I was finally loaded around 8:30 PM CST and got out of there around 8:45 PM CST. I drove east on interstate 40 to West Memphis, Arkansas where I picked up interstate 55 north. I followed in interstate 55 north into Missouri as my day was ending---little did I know the adventure that was waiting for me!!!

FIRST 5 YEARS:(Wednesday-traveling in Texas)
I stopped for a 3 hour napping Kendleton, Texas. After the 3 hour nap I continued on highway 59 until I got to interstate 10 in side Houston. I took interstate 10 east into Louisiana and got two Lake Charles around 9:00 AM CST. I got off the interstate and follow the directions I had. Boy what a time. The roads were far too small for the semi trucks. Finally found the customer and was unloaded quite rapidly.
After I was unloaded I called dispatch and was given aload to pick up in Forrest City, Arkansas. I handed out on the small little roads back to the interstate. I got on interstate 10 going east to highway 165. I continue to Alexandria, Louisiana where I tooky break at a Wal-Mart store. I walked around the store and went to the pharmacy to get some aspirin or something. I needed to clean the trailer and so I didn't here. I continued up highway 165 through Monroe, Louisiana where the smell of refineries was really heavy in the air. I stayed on 165 to Arkansas and up to highway 1 which I followed to Forrest city. I got there after dark and my appointment wasn't until 8:00 the next day to get loaded. I just parked outside the customer's gate, turned it on my television, watched it and went to sleep... I did not know the adventure that was waiting for me! ! !
